Wind Tunnel Testing For Drag Reduction Of An Aircraft Laser Turret, Christopher H. Snyder Jun 1998

Wind Tunnel Testing For Drag Reduction Of An Aircraft Laser Turret, Christopher H. Snyder

Theses and Dissertations

This study investigated the use of aft-mounted fairings and splitter plates to reduce the drag of a half-scale aircraft laser turret. Forces, moments, and pressure distributions were measured in the AFIT 1.5-m (5-ft) wind tunnel at Reynolds numbers between 3x10 to the 5th power and 9x10 to the 5th power based on the turret diameter. Oil traces indicated the nature of the flow near the surface of the unmodified turret and the surrounding area.
